The Eel

Bruce Clifton
Key Words:
Emotion - Strength - Endurance

What is the spiritual Meaning or Essence of the Eel?
The spiritual meaning of the eel is one of endurance and perseverence, the eel will only ever move forward. The eel symbolises overcoming all obstacles, moving through and making progress.

Why does the Eel appear now?
The Eel will appear in times of trouble, it has mastered the art of patience, knowing when to wait and when to move forward. It is one of our ancient beings and has evolved into the fish we know it as today, ancient wisdom from many generations is passed down through its lineage.


How do I call upon the Eel?
Patience is an art bestowed upon the eel, it is the eel that will come to you and it is your choice to recognise their energy. They will lead you through any storm and deliver you safely onto a sunsoaked beach.

To dream of the Eel.
Means there is a storm ahead or the storm has passed. The eel will make good use of troubled waters to find its food, to grow in strength, prosper and settle after the storm has passed.

The Eel like a snake can take many forms, the eel lives in both fresh water and sea water, during its life it will undergo a metamphosis to develop into the Eel. 

Like the salmon, Eel comes back to the fresh water rivers and lakes
as a part of ancestoral heritage. The evolution of the eel, the ancient ancestors, its heritage is never forgotten. From past life to this life and to carry it forward into the next life, the eel will remember the breeding grounds. It will adapt its form, its colour and remember ancient ritual for breeding and finding a mate. The eel has been known to crawl across fields and meadows to reach the breeding grounds of its ancestors. 
​
The Eel lives a solitary life only seeking company to breed, it is happiest in a fresh water river and is predatory to younger, smaller fish, frogs, carcasses and even small birds. Its ability to blend into natural surroundings makes it very difficult for predators to see and find. 

The Eel brings forward strength, masculinity, it can face strong currents with ease and is able to swim against the tide. The Eel symbolises overcoming difficulties and moving through the storm.
The versatility of the Eel also symbolises divine feminity, the beauty and movement of always moving forward never backwards, the ocean or river and the tides and eternal ebb and flow of life, represent the eternal circle of the moon.

If Eel appears in your dreams it is a warning of a storm to come, or one that you have overcome and can relax. The strength of the eel will allow you to move on and be successful in all your endeavours. Allow the energy of the eel to lead you forward to safety or success.

The ancient wisdom from the eel comes from old age and generations that have lived before, Some species of eel are capable of living more than 100 years in this life. The secret of its old age is simplicity, it lives a single solitary life and is happy to do so. It enjoys company to reproduce and ensure its continual survival. The life of the hermit is one of wisdom, independence, peace and self love.
